PCB in final stage of announcing central contracts

The Pakistan Cricket Board (PCB) has reportedly still not finalised the central contracts for its men’s cricketers, which has expired on Wednesday.

As per reports, the PCB officials are still working on the contracts and the fitness of the players is the main concern for them.

Although, it was earlier reportes that the PCB will hand the new contracts before Pakistan’s tour of England however, that didn’t happened.

Meanwhile, it has been reported that the new contracts are under review and in the final stages. It is likely that the new contracts will be announced either this week or at the start of the next week.

As per reports, performance and fitness of the players would be the priority for the new contracts.

Reports also suggest that Hassan Ali and Faheem Ashraf are most likely to find a place in the contract while Sohaib Maqsood and Shahanawaz Dahani are also being considered for it.
